Telemedicine teleplay therapy allows healthcare providers to deliver therapy services remotely, making mental health support more accessible to individuals who may not be able to attend in-person sessions. This has become especially important in light of the COVID-19 pandemic, which has highlighted the need for remote healthcare services.
